What is Machine Learning?
Machine learning is a branch of artificial intelligence that allows machines to learn from data without the need for explicit programming. Instead of peru mobile database following rigid rules, the system analyzes patterns in large volumes of information and makes predictions or decisions based on those patterns.
Unlike other AI technologies that rely on predefined rules, Machine Learning is dynamic and improves as it receives new data. In today’s environment, where massive amounts of data are constantly being generated through online interactions, shopping, social media, and connected devices, Machine Learning has become essential for transforming data into actionable insights.
Machine Learning Applications in Marketing
Machine learning is transforming marketing strategies in many ways. Let’s explore some of the main practical applications:
Mass customization
Consumers expect personalized experiences, and machine learning makes this possible at scale. By analyzing browsing behavior, purchase history, and previous interactions, machine learning algorithms can identify patterns and offer highly personalized recommendations for products, services, and content.
For example, e-commerce platforms like Amazon use Machine Learning to suggest products based on customer preferences, increasing the chances of conversion and improving the user experience.
Campaign automation
Machine learning is also transforming marketing automation. Automation tools that use this technology can optimize campaigns in real time by adjusting bids, segmenting audiences, and optimizing ads based on up-to-date data. This saves time and resources while maximizing campaign efficiency.
